What does MATRONLY mean?
MATRONLY adjective- In the capacity of a matron; serving as a housekeeper or head nurse.
- Exuding the authority, wisdom, power, and intelligence of an experienced woman.
- Having the appearance of a mature woman, often of larger physical stature and somewhat unkempt or dowdy.
- In the manner of a matron.
